Nike: Sheryl Swoopes, Lisa Leslie, Cynthia Cooper, Dawn Staley, Chamique Holdsclaw, Diana Taurasi, Elena Delle Donne, Sabrina Ionescu, & Caitlin Clarke (coming soon). Adidas: Candace Parker. Fila: Nikki McCray. Reebok: Rebecca Lobo. Puma: Breanna Stewart.
